Hi I like to know your thought on weather you think I should drive and ask people to become followers on my Linkedin Company page when I set up a blog for instance or should my

Hi Gary I like what you are saying with driving traffic to your Linkedin company page I guess I would ask the question can your linkedin page suffice as an effective primer that will lead to your company website.
I honestly feel you should set up your website have engaging content that you can use to interact with your prospective customers, answer their questions and so on. I feel it is one less step that your customers will need to go through yet it eliminates the cold landing that they would experience if they went directly to the company site.
Having a website that has at least 2 internal links per post will help your site rank better and also really engage your readers. I would also have one internal link that all posts use to direct consumers to a page that outlines your company's attributes, fee structure, mission statement, fee structure all the good stuff your company has to offer. This page will then have an external link that would take them to your company's sales page.
Once you get people to the last stop on your website ask for feedback people like to interact and that in Googles eyes is also content which helps you rank. Comments are powerful, you want comments you want to engage on your site as well as behind the scenes with a private email option, possibly down the road use your site to engage in email campaigns, offer some perk for people to leave an email address, that sort of thing it might work better on your site than trying it on the company site.
Essentially what you have done here is create your own sales funnel and by the time your traffic gets through your site they are ready to buy, it's very professional not spammy which you I am sure you want.
Not sure what your company is so I can't speak directly to how I would arrange the content but we can figure that out down the road when you get the main structure set up. Any more questions feel free to fire away, talk soon Mike.
P.S it's not good enough to rank just under your company search result you want to have a high presence everywhere that your company has relevance and you can achieve that with good keyword selection and great content!
